Wellcraft Scarab (updated 2024-11-30)
Duration: 8:41
1.9K views | 9 Oct 2017
1.9K views | 9 Oct 2017
Duration: 1:08
931 views | 13 May 2014
931 views | 13 May 2014
Duration: 1:22
6.9K views | 31 Jul 2007
6.9K views | 31 Jul 2007
New on site